A woman who tried to purchase a second Nutribullet for her mother with cancer was amazed when a stranger bought her a new one.

Cara Grace Duggan wrote to a seller on online sales site Gumtree asking about the juicer, wanting to buy one for her mother Kim who has cancer. After telling the seller in London her story, he offered to let her have it for free before ordering her a brand new one.



Duggan shared the generous gesture on Facebook. “Today I emailed a stranger on gumtree about a second hand 900w Nutribullet. We've been needing the higher wattage for mums supplements. I needed him to post from London so briefly explained why we wanted it. This is what happened....”

When Duggan received a message saying she had an order to collect, she wrote to the seller: “I’m confused. Did you buy a new one? How is it ready today?”

He replied: “Yes I bought the new one and it’s paid for. You just need to collect it… Don’t say thanks to me. In fact, thanks to you for giving me this opportunity.”

After sharing the exchange on Facebook, Duggan revealed that she cried when she collected the juicer, describing the donor as “the kindest man ever.”

The family had set up a Go Fund Me page to raise money for Kim’s treatment. Donations have sky-rocketed since this story went viral.
